Package Details: ptokax 0.4.2.0-2

Package Base: ptokax
Description: A Direct Connect Hub Peer-To-Peer sharing network.
Upstream URL: http://www.ptokax.org
Category: network
Licenses: GPL3
Submitter: None
Maintainer: grant
Last Packager: None
Votes: 2
First Submitted: 2010-09-06 16:57
Last Updated: 2012-10-14 03:19

Latest Comments

Comment by kopiersperre

2014-11-30 15:17

update to 0.5.0.2 would be great

Anonymous comment

2012-12-15 05:29

und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aSetManLib.o: In function `SetHubSlotRatio':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aSetManLib.cpp:437: und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aSetManLib.cpp:438: und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aSetManLib.o: In function `SetNumber':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aSetManLib.cpp:210: und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aSetManLib.o:/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aSetManLib.cpp:211: more undefined references to `lua_tonumber' follow
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aSetManLib.o: In function `RegSetMan(lua_State*)':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aSetManLib.cpp:714: undefined reference to `luaL_register'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aTmrManLib.o: In function `AddTimer':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aTmrManLib.cpp:147: und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aTmrManLib.o: In function `RegTmrMan(lua_State*)':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aTmrManLib.cpp:266: undefined reference to `luaL_register'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aUDPDbgLib.o: In function `Reg':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aUDPDbgLib.cpp:78: undefined reference to `lua_tonumber'
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/obj/LuaUDPDbgLib.o: In function `RegUDPDbg(lua_State*)':
/tmp/yaourt-tmp-shyam/aur-ptokax/src/PtokaX/core/LuaUDPDbgLib.cpp:166: undefined reference to `luaL_register'
collect2: error: ld returned 1 exit status
make: *** [PtokaX] Error 1
==> ERROR: A failure occurred in build().
Aborting...
==> ERROR: Makepkg was unable to build ptokax.



"luasocket" has been removed from pacman repository, and has been replace hby "lua-socket", "lua51-socket" ... Now I am getting the error that I have pasted above. In order to install luasocket back, I used package from "downgrade", but still the error is still there.

Comment by shadyabhi

2011-02-27 02:37

@dve

For 64-bit users,
3rd last line in ptokax64.patch should be

$(CURDIR)/tinyxml/tinyxml.a /usr/lib/liblua.a

Anonymous comment

2010-10-10 12:21

t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/serviceLoop.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/SettingManager.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/TextFileManager.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/UdpDebug.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/UDPThread.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/User.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/utility.o /t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/obj/ZlibUtility.o \
/tmp/packerbuild-0/ptokax/ptokax/src/PtokaX/tinyxml/tinyxml.a /usr/lib64/liblua.a
g++: /usr/lib64/liblua.a: No such file or directory
make: *** [PtokaX] Error 1
L'operazione sta per essere interrotta...

there's error.

Anonymous comment

2010-10-10 08:29

The patch for 64 bit is included and should be automatically applied by the PKGBUILD when ran on a 64bit computer. I haven't tested it on one though. Do you get some error?

Anonymous comment

2010-10-10 08:07

Hi,thx for the pkg.Can u explain the right way for patch installation on 64bit thanks?